The Chamber of Digital Commerce, also called The Digital Chamber, is a trade association for companies in the digital asset and blockchain industry. It lobbies on banking, financial institutions and securities, and commodities issues—mainly related to regulation of crypto and blockchain. Recent filings show work preparing responses to questions from SEC Commissioner Hester Peirce.
